Small Business Loans

You are eligible to apply for OCLF small business loans if:

  • You are 18 years or older and not attending school on a full-time basis.
  • You live in the City of Ottawa and have permanent
    legal status in Canada.
  • You have sole ownership in the company or partners that are willing to co-sign for the business loan.
  • You can demonstrate to the satisfaction of OCLF
    that you can fully repay the loan.
  • If applicable, you have been discharged from bankruptcy.
  • You can submit a complete business plan including
    start-up or expansion costs, and a cash flow forecast.
  • You have participated in a business training program
    associated with OCLF or, you are presently operating
    a business and can supply the required documentation or;
  • you have experience in a similar business.

Your business must:

  • Be located in the City of Ottawa and operates a minimum of 10 hours per week.
  • Not be a network marketing business.
  • Be, or will be, a legally registered sole proprietorship,
    partnership, corporation or co-operative.
  • Use the funds to start or expand business operations.
  • Not be applying the funds to consolidate debt.

Internationally-Trained Professional Loans

You are eligible to apply for the OCLF Internationally-trained Professional loans if:

  • You are 18 years or older and you have been accepted into a recognized accreditation program for Internationally-trained professionals.
  • You have been referred to the OCLF by one of these accreditation programs.
  • You live in the City of Ottawa and have permanent
    legal status in Canada.
  • You can demonstrate to the satisfaction of OCLF
    that you can fully repay the loan.
  • If applicable, you have been discharged from bankruptcy.

Canadian Youth Business Foundation Loans (website)

You are eligible to apply for a Canadian Youth Business Foundation Loan if:

  • You are between 18-34 years old
  • You are eligible to work in Canada
  • You have some training/experience related to their business idea
  • You agree to work with a mentor for the duration of the loan term (3 to 5 years)
  • You can produce a complete and viable business plan
  • You live or open the business in Ottawa (primarily), Eastern Ontario (with exceptions)
  • You have a business that creates or leads to full-time sustainable employment for the applicant
  • If you have claimed bankruptcy, it has been at least 5 years since your discharge
  • Loans may be approved for new business (less than one year) only, and may not be approved for growth capital for existing businesses
  • Network or multi-level marketing businesses are not eligible
  • For a partnership of two, the principal or general partner must meet the age criteria and both are subject to the CYBF application process
  • If the business is incorporated, the applicant must be a majority shareholder, having at least 51% of the voting shares, and be involved in the day-to-day management of the business

If the business is incorporated with more than two shareholders and no one person holds majority shares, the shareholders meeting the age criteria must collectively hold the majority of the voting shares and be involved in the day-to-day management of the business. All applicants are subject to the CYBF application.
